Legal-Entity & Governance Consolidation
Maps and rationalises the combined legal-entity and governance structure, tracking board and statutory changes across two countries.

The Challenge
Cross-border mergers introduce complex legal-entity, board, and statutory governance changes. Managing them manually increases the risk of compliance gaps, audit findings, and regulatory delays.
How It Works
- Ingests entity registers, board and delegation records and statutory requirements.
- RAG maps required changes per jurisdiction and drafts filings and resolutions.
- Tracks each change to completion with a defensible governance audit trail.
